Terminal Operator
3 months ago
The Role:
The Terminal Operator is generally responsible for the safe receipt, storage, and delivery of bulk liquids of a flammable or hazardous characteristic including the general upkeep and security of the establishment.
Principal Responsibilities:
- Monitoring tank levels, particularly when filling.
- Responding to Safety Critical System Alarms and taking appropriate action to prevent an incident.
- Carrying out routine inspection of tank bunds. Draining surface water in bunds as necessary.
- Dipping storage tanks and draining water from tanks in accordance with work procedures.
- Sampling and testing of Tank Water Bottoms for microbiological growth.
- The correct operation of all Terminal Drainage Systems, Interceptors and Outfalls and adhering to procedures regarding the release of water from such systems.
- Checking laboratory testing equipment ensuring that it is in calibration and in good working order.
- Maintaining cleanliness of laboratory and sample storage area.
- Operation of all Road Vehicle loading equipment being able to assist with loading of Road Tankers as required. Check and clean Line Filters and Pump Filters as required.
- The operation of all Fuel additive and Marker Systems. Operating Fuel Marker Systems directed by the Contract Manager. Overseeing Fuel Additive receipts.
- Reporting any defects in material/plant.
- Carrying out Terminal Housekeeping Duties as required.
